One goes In the front of the shift lever and the other ones goes behind it. The purpose is to stop the lever from going too far and damaging your transmission. I'd assume especially useful in aggressive shifting situations. From that write up, you put the car in each gear and then adjust the stops to where there's not much more travel left in the shifter once it's seated in the gear.
